Licensing Act 2003 - Notice of Application for Grant of a Premises License/Club Premises Certificate

We (Michael Beckett) of Unit 705 Merlin Park, Ringtail Road, L40 8JY have applied to West Lancashire Brough Council for a license to establish a wine shop/wine tasting venue.

Opening hours will be between 10 a.m. and 8 p.m.

The application may be inspected at West Lancashire Borough Council, Licensing Section, Robert Hedge Centre, Stanley Way, Skelmersdale, WN8 8EE, between hours of 9.00 a.m. and 4.30 p.m. on Monday to Friday inclusive. Brief details can also be obtained from the Councils website http://westlancs.gov.uk/licensing

Any interested party may make representations in writing to the council regarding the application before September 25th 2024.

It is an offence, knowingly or recklessly to make a false statement in connection with an application and on summary conviction anyone doing so is liable to a fine of £5,000.
